AWWA Staff Executive Director Linda Schier is one of the founding members of AWWA. A former President of the Great East Lake Improvement Association, Linda became the President of AWWA in 2005. As the project load grew Linda accepted the position as part-time Executive Director. Linda holds a B.A. in Political Science and an M.A. in Environmental Education from UNH and is a volunteer with the UNH Marine Docent Program. Program Director Howard Dupee comes with many years of experience in nonprofit management, working with youth and land use policies. He will be responsible for working with property owners to reduce the impact of runoff into the waterbodies within the local watersheds. One of his main duties will be overseeing AWWA’s summer Youth Conservation Corps funded in part by the NHDES, private grants and local communities.
